>> Looking at the contents of the /proc/PID/ns/time_for_children
>> symlink shows an anomaly:
>>
>> $ ls -l /proc/self/ns/* |awk '{print $9, $10, $11}'
>> ...
>> /proc/self/ns/pid -> pid:[4026531836]
>> /proc/self/ns/pid_for_children -> pid:[4026531836]
>> /proc/self/ns/time -> time:[4026531834]
>> /proc/self/ns/time_for_children -> time_for_children:[4026531834]
>> /proc/self/ns/user -> user:[4026531837]
>> ...
>>
>> The reference for 'time_for_children' should be a 'time' namespace,
>> just as the reference for 'pid_for_children' is a 'pid' namespace.
>> In other words, I think the above time_for_children link should read:
>>
>> /proc/self/ns/time_for_children -> time:[4026531834]
